The Dollar Rise: A Cause for Concern Amid Investor Anxiety
The New Year Dilemma
As the new year unfolds, the continuous rise of the dollar presents both opportunities and challenges for investors. The strengthening dollar often signals economic stability, but it also raises concerns regarding the potential for an asset bubble. Investors are increasingly asking: Is there a bubble, and when might it burst?
Understanding the Bubble Dynamics
Market analysts warn that while a strong dollar can boost purchasing power, it can also lead to inflated asset prices. Historically, when investors begin to question the sustainability of a rising dollar, panic selling can ensue, ultimately leading to a market correction. Thus, understanding the dynamics surrounding the dollar’s rise is crucial for making informed investment decisions.
Signs of a Potential Correction
Key indicators suggest we might be entering a pivotal phase. First, observe consumer confidence levels and spending patterns. As the dollar strengthens, imported goods become cheaper, which can lead to increased consumption. However, an over-reliance on a strong dollar may cause economic vulnerabilities. Furthermore, central bank policy changes could serve as critical triggers for a potential market adjustment.
